Botanical Garden
The Botanical Garden of the Faculty of Science at Masaryk University, located in the Veveří district of Brno, has been serving both the academic community and the general public for over a hundred years. It currently maintains a collection comprising over 4,000 plant taxa, situated in the outdoor area and in the recently renovated greenhouses.
The garden is open all year round. The outdoor displays are freely accessible during opening hours. To enter the greenhouses, ring the bell at the entrance beneath the spiral staircase, where you will also find a map of the garden. You will find labels next to the plants and information boards at each display. In the greenhouses, there are also audio panels with commentary in Czech and English. At the greenhouse ticket office, you can purchase souvenirs, information materials and printed guides.
